• Alon II Speakers

    •⁠  Overview – The Alon II Speakers, released in the mid-1990s, are American-designed open-baffle hybrid loudspeakers featuring a dynamic woofer and dipole mid/tweeter array for expansive, room-filling soundstage realism.

    •⁠  Open-Baffle Design – Utilizing a dipole midrange and tweeter configuration, Alon II Speakers create exceptional spatial depth and imaging precision, minimizing box coloration while delivering natural, airy high-frequency extension.

    •⁠  Bass Performance – A sealed dynamic woofer provides articulate, tuneful low-frequency response, blending seamlessly with the open midrange section to produce balanced tonality and impressive dynamic scale in medium-sized rooms.

    •⁠  Specifications – 2-way hybrid dipole design, sensitivity approximately 87–89 dB, nominal 4-ohm impedance, recommended amplification 50–200 W, frequency response extending roughly 30 Hz–20 kHz, optimized for high-current solid-state amplification.

    •⁠  Dimensions – Each cabinet measures approximately 39 in high × 12 in wide × 15 in deep, with an open rear mid/high section requiring thoughtful room placement for best performance.

    •⁠  Weight – Each speaker weighs approximately 60–70 lbs (27–32 kg), reflecting solid cabinetry, substantial crossover components and robust driver assemblies.

  • TAD Evolution One TX

    Product Overview – The TAD Evolution One TX (2016) is a high-end floorstanding loudspeaker engineered in Japan, combining studio-grade accuracy with refined musicality for reference-level two-channel listening environments.

    Driver Technology – Utilizing TAD’s Coherent Source Transducer with beryllium tweeter and midrange diaphragm, the TAD Evolution One TX delivers exceptional phase coherence, pinpoint imaging, and ultra-low distortion across the audible spectrum.

    Cabinet & Voicing – A rigid, low-resonance enclosure with curved side panels minimizes standing waves, allowing the speaker to produce deep, controlled bass while preserving tonal neutrality and dynamic realism at high playback levels.

    Specifications – Nominal impedance 4 ohms, sensitivity approximately 90 dB, frequency response around 28 Hz–60 kHz, recommended amplifier power 50–300 W, optimized for high-current solid-state or quality tube amplification.

    Dimensions – Each speaker measures approximately 400 mm wide × 1,154 mm high × 530 mm deep, designed as a full-scale reference floorstander suitable for medium to large dedicated listening rooms.

    Weight – Each unit weighs roughly 95 kg, reflecting extensive internal bracing and premium materials that contribute to mechanical stability, resonance control, and consistent acoustic performance.

  • TAD Compact Reference CR1

    •⁠  Overview – TAD Compact Reference CR1, released in 2011, is a high-end standmount loudspeaker engineered to deliver reference-level neutrality, precision imaging, and studio-grade accuracy derived from TAD’s professional monitor heritage.

    •⁠  Driver Technology – Featuring TAD’s proprietary concentric CST driver with beryllium tweeter and magnesium midrange, it achieves point-source coherence, exceptional phase alignment, and ultra-low distortion across the audible frequency range.

    •⁠  Sonic Performance – TAD Compact Reference CR1 is celebrated for its transparency, holographic soundstage, and tonal realism, excelling with acoustic, orchestral, and complex recordings where timing and micro-detail are critical.

    •⁠  Specifications – Two-way bass-reflex design, nominal 4-ohm impedance, sensitivity approx. 87 dB, frequency response roughly 45 Hz–100 kHz, rear-firing port, and high-quality crossover components optimized for minimal signal loss.

    •⁠  Dimensions – Approx. 410 mm (H) × 250 mm (W) × 360 mm (D), offering a substantial standmount form factor designed for rigid placement on dedicated speaker stands in reference listening environments.

    •⁠  Weight – Approximately 18 kg per speaker, reflecting dense cabinet construction, internal bracing, and premium driver assemblies required for resonance control and uncompromised acoustic performance.

  • JBL Synthesis Project Array 1400

    High-Performance Overview – The JBL Synthesis Project Array 1400, launched around 2007, is a flagship floorstanding loudspeaker using a Bi-Radial horn and powerful low-frequency system to deliver dynamic, room-filling cinema-grade sound.

    Horn-Loaded Precision – The JBL Synthesis Project Array 1400 features a titanium compression driver and advanced horn geometry, providing exceptional clarity, wide dispersion, and precise imaging ideal for both music and home-theater environments.

    Deep, Controlled Bass – A massive 14-inch Neodymium woofer delivers authoritative low frequencies with excellent transient response, enabling the Project Array 1400 to handle demanding low-end material while maintaining accuracy and control.

    Ultra-High Output Capability – With high sensitivity and robust driver construction, the JBL Synthesis Project Array 1400 achieves reference-level dynamics, low distortion, and impactful realism even at elevated listening levels.

    Dimensions – Approx. 1,115 mm (H) × 508 mm (W) × 406 mm (D). Large cabinet volume supports deep bass extension and wide sound dispersion across medium to large rooms.

    Weight – Approx. 64 kg per speaker, providing exceptional mechanical stability and reducing cabinet resonance for cleaner, more accurate acoustic performance.
